Re: Sebastian de Vlloa


 
There are no parents identified in this record.  This is a problem that has become a block wall for me on several lines.  For a series of years (about the first third of the 18th century, 1752, 1785) no parents are identified for any of the "pretensos" -- the bride and groom -- on the microfilmed records for marriages in Nochistlan.  Since the abuelos were not indentified in the christening records till the latter part of 1798, where do I turn without having to make a trip to Nochistlan to break down these walls?  So far I have only looked at the films of matrimonios and bautismos on loan from the Family History Center in SLC.
